Multiverse Theory and Higher Dimensions
The idea that our universe might be one among many has gained traction in modern
physics, notably through multiverse theories. These propose that multiple universes or
dimensions exist parallel to our own, each with distinct physical laws and properties.
Some foundational theories include:
String Theory: Suggests that particles are one-dimensional strings vibrating in
higher-dimensional space, typically requiring 10 or 11 dimensions.
Brane Cosmology: Proposes that our universe exists on a membrane (brane)
within a higher-dimensional space, allowing for possible interactions or gateways
2
between dimensions.
Quantum Mechanics: The phenomenon of quantum entanglement and
superposition hints at interconnected realities beyond our perception.
